Admittedly Bruges are no great shakes and did very well to get this far.
But Benfica have been impressive. Still unbeaten in this year's CL (including 2 rounds of qualification before the group stage) - their
record is 10 wins and two draws. Good work for any team, but
considering they sold players for (reportedly) 260,000,000 Euros
(including Fernandez in Jan) and bought for only 88 Million (two
expensive acquisitions in Jan) they are clearly doing something right.
Only one defeat (to Braga) in the league as well.
If I were into betting, I think I would put some money on them as dark horses to win the whole thing.
